Detection and Prevention
Taking your dog to a specialist groomer will benefit you greatly. It’s the ultimate way to detect any issues that your dog may have, and early detection is very important just like you catch it early treatment may very well be shorter and easier – of course depending on what it is.

The groomer can look for rashes, lesions, inflammation, lumps, or infections that any normal pet owner could miss. You’ll have the ability to prevent any major health conditions or catch an underlying problem, that you may have had no idea about.

So, the sooner a problem is found, the quicker you’ll have the ability to treat your pet and nurse them back again to health.

Maintaining a wholesome Coat and Fur
Maintaining a wholesome coat and fur for your pet means you need to groom them frequently. They can’t just jump into the shower and clean themselves as we can.

Plus, it’s not even ideal to give them a normal bath. Regular bathing may cause their natural oil to fallout, and it’ll also damage their coat.

What you can do is brush them. Any responsible and seasoned dog owner will know that brushing your pet benefits them greatly. It can help to avoid mats in their fur. They can make the hair knot up, or pull on the tight skin, that may cause them discomfort and pain.

Mats can also cause ulcers and abrasions. Brushing provides out the natural oils in the fur and remove any dead hair, dirt, and dandruff. Your pet will have a wholesome shine with their coat and will also feel healthy themselves.

Whilst brushing your pet is great additionally it is beneficial to comb them through with an excellent comb as this may reveal fleas that you might not be familiar with.

Taking Care of their Nails
With regards to grooming, you must not just forget about their nails. Uncut nails can result in joint pain, as this means the dog may not be walking with pads in alignment. That is quite a universal problem in dogs. Trimmed nails could keep them from curling, and can stop germs from getting stuck within.

If you do opt to do this, spend money on some proper nail clippers that are made specifically for dogs. This will make cutting their nails easier and can also make it less painful for your dog. If you’re nervous concerning this ask your vet for advice.

Great things about Regular Grooming and Brushing
If you’re still sceptical about how regular grooming can benefit both you as well as your dog, here are a few different ways it can make your daily life easier.

Using a well groomed, clean, and nice smelling dog throughout the house means that your home will be less inclined to have bad odors gathering in your home. Regular grooming also causes less shedding from your dog.

You don’t have to vacuum clean your home every day if you maintain with the grooming. You’re also eliminating and stopping fleas and ticks from settling in as well.

The best part is, a good brushing session can make you bond with your pet, and who doesn’t love creating good memories using their dogs?
